The Young Artists programme for 10–18 year olds offers a unique opportunity to students from all backgrounds who want to develop their drawing skills.

Students aged 10–14 with an interest and aptitude for drawing can join our weekly Drawing Clubs. The Young Associates programme is for students aged 15–18 looking to continue their creative studies. Fee paying and full scholarship places are offered on both programmes. Weekly classes are held on Saturdays at venues including the School’s Shoreditch studios, The National Gallery, Notting Dale Campus, online and out of house in the city. Students have the opportunity to draw from the model, directly from artworks as well as developing studio responses from drawings made in the streets and green spaces of London. In addition to the weekly term time courses for young artists, the Royal Drawing School also offers intensive one week holiday courses in the school holidays as well as occasional one-day pop up courses.

The Young Artists programme is taught by professional artists who are alumni of our postgraduate programme, The Drawing Year.
